DAVIESS COMMUNITY HOSPITAL FOUNDATION RECEIVES GRANT

Daviess Community Hospital Foundation was notified today that they are the recipient of a Rapid Response Grant. The grant amount of $5,000.00 will be used to cover the cost of additional Personal Protective Equipment which has been purchased in preparation for a potential surge in patients

This grant was made possible by the Rapid Response Funds from the following Community Foundations:

  • Daviess County Community Foundation
  • Pike County Community Foundation

The Community Foundation Alliance, Inc., the legal entity through which each of our affiliate Community Foundations operate, is making this grant in furtherance of a charitable purpose as defined by Internal Revenue Code Section 501(c)(3)

“We are very grateful to the Daviess County and Pike County Community Foundations for these funds,” said Angie Steiner, Director of Business Development at DCH. “This grant will help offset the costs already incurred for the purchase of personal protective equipment (PPE) such as masks, gloves, sanitizing products, gowns, thermometers, soap, syringes, air scrubbers, shields, protective eyewear and ventilators.”
